description Product Description

This compound is primarily utilized in pharmaceutical research and development, particularly in the synthesis of biologically active molecules. It serves as a key intermediate in the creation of compounds targeting neurological disorders, such as anxiety and depression, due to its structural similarity to piperidine derivatives, which are known to interact with central nervous system receptors. Additionally, it is employed in the development of potential anticancer agents, as the fluoropiperidine moiety can enhance the binding affinity and selectivity of drug candidates to specific cellular targets. Its carbamate group also provides stability and facilitates controlled release of active pharmaceutical ingredients in drug formulations.
